Key Responsibilities:
- Strategic Alignment & Planning:
- Partner with leadership in Sales, Marketing, and Account Management to create and execute a cohesive revenue strategy.
- Lead revenue forecasting, planning, and budgeting processes, ensuring goals are realistic and data-driven.
- Track performance against targets and provide regular updates to executive leadership.
- Sales Enablement & Optimization:
- Implement tools, playbooks, and training to increase sales productivity and improve conversion rates.
- Ensure Salesforce and other CRM tools are fully utilized, optimized, and aligned to meet the team’s needs.
- Oversee lead scoring, routing, and lifecycle stages, ensuring high-quality leads are passed to sales.
- Data Analytics & Insights:
- Develop and maintain dashboards and reports for visibility into revenue-driving metrics (pipeline health, CAC, churn, etc.).
- Analyze sales, marketing, and customer success data to provide actionable insights and identify bottlenecks or areas of improvement.
- Conduct regular reviews of key KPIs, sharing findings with stakeholders to inform strategy.
- Process Improvement & Automation:
- Map and improve processes across the revenue lifecycle, from lead generation to deal closure and renewal.
